I'll bathe you in bubbles and soak you in sun, then wrap you up tightly when bath time is done. With two loving hands, an adoring mother cradles her baby after bath time and a devoted father lifts his newborn to look into a nest. Sister, brother, grandma, and grandpa all can't wait to share what they love best with their newest family member. And when it is time to step out into the world, this caring family is right there alongside their littlest one. In simple, heartfelt language, this soothing picture book for the very young will tug at the heartstrings and remind us all of the caring hands that helped us along our way.

A delightful way to show little ones how their hands are a blessing from God that they can use to do help others. Written in rhyming text and illustrated with the charming art of Gaby Hansen, this simple message of God’s blessing of hands not only entertains . . . as it teaches what wonderful things our hands can do from scratching, latching, and petting a pup to washing dishes with mommy and putting toys in a box . . . but it also conveys the important message: We can use God’s gift of hands to show our love for Him by helping others. The book ends tenderly with a prayer of thanks to God for hands and asks Him to use them again: One hand, two hands, Five fingers, ten. God, thanks, for my hands. Please, use them again.

Adversity is not an optional item on life’s menu. We live in a fast and dangerous world. At some point, life won’t go as planned. You will face adversity. A proper response to adversity, on the other hand, is optional. Life can turn upside down faster than we want to acknowledge. From the time an avalanche fractured to the time I was violently crushed into a tree and buried was twelve seconds. In a mere twelve seconds, I went from hero to zero. I was always the type that grabbed hold of life with both hands and made the best of it. I was known as one of the best sets of hands behind the handlebars of a snowmobile. Then life slid out. The avalanche nearly took my life, and I came out of a lengthy coma and recovery with a hand I can’t use. By the hand of God and the amazing people in my life, I’ve never been without two hands.
